# 实现 Python 流式输入的步骤教程 流式输入(streaming input)是一种在数据源与数据处理之间持续传递数据的方式。对应于 Python,我们通常是通过使用标准输入(stdin)读取数据。本文将指导你如何实现简单的流式输入。 ## 流程步骤 以下是实现流式输入的基本步骤: | 步骤 | 描述 | |------|--
原创 2024-10-27 04:47:41
54阅读
本节内容:I/O操作概述文件读写实现原理与操作步骤文件打开模式Python文件操作步骤示例Python文件读取相关方法文件读写与字符编码一、I/O操作概述I/O在计算机中是指Input/Output,也就是Stream(流)的输入和输出。这里的输入和输出是相对于内存来说的,Input Stream(输入流)是指数据从外(磁盘、网络)流进内存,Output Stream是数据从内存流出到外面(磁盘、
转载 2023-10-13 16:34:22
240阅读
(流)流按照方向分,分为两种输入流和输出流,是以内存作为参照物。当从数据源中,将数据读取到内存中时,叫做输入流,也叫读取流将内存中的数据写入到数据源时,叫做输入流,也叫写入流流按照传输的内容分,分为:字节流,字符流,对象流。无论是哪一种流,底层部分都是以字节流方式传输。所以,基本质都是字节流,但是为了方便程序员更好的操作字符数据和对象数据,所以,在字节流基础上做了一层包装,形成了字符流和对象。字节
一、简单文件写入异步:fs.writeFile(file,data[,option],callback) 同步:fs.writeFileSync(file,data[,options])file:要操作的文件的路径data:要被写入的内容,可以是 String 或 Bufferoptions:包含属性(encoding、mode、 flag)例:{flag : “r”},表示文件打开状态为只读,详
先看看官方资料对单脉冲模式的介绍下面看C代码的实现void PWM_GPIO_Init( void ) { PC_DDR_DDR6 = 1; //输出管脚 PC6 TIM1_CH1 PC_CR1_C16 = 1; //推挽输出 PC_CR2_C26 = 1;
这里以将Apache的日志写入到ElasticSearch为例,来演示一下如何使用Python将Spark数据导入到ES中。实际工作中,由于数据与使用框架或技术的复杂性,数据的写入变得比较复杂,在这里我们简单演示一下。如果使用Scala或Java的话,Spark提供自带了支持写入ES的支持库,但Python不支持。所以首先你需要去这里下载依赖的ES官方开发的依赖包包。下载完成后,放在本地目录,以下
转载 2023-07-14 14:48:29
166阅读
源代码: Lib/fileinput.py此模块实现了一个辅助类和一些函数用来快速编写访问标准输入或文件列表的循环。 如果你只想要读写一个文件请参阅 open().典型用法为:import fileinput for line in fileinput.input(): process(line)这将遍历sys中列出的所有文件的行。argv[1:]如果列表是空的,默认为sys。如果文件名是'-',
Java IO(一)概述一、IO概述(一)、介绍在Java中,所有的数据都是通过流读写的,Java提供了IO来处理设备之间的数据传输,Java程序中,对于数据的输入/输出操作 都是以“流”的方式进行的。java.io包下提供了各种“流”类的接口,用以获取不同种类的数据,并通过标准的方法输入或输出数据。对于计算机来说,数据都是以二进制形式读出或写入的。我们可以把文件想象为一个桶,我们可以通过管道将桶
转载 2023-06-26 22:34:44
298阅读
高效语音识别利器:ASR-iOS-Local该项目是开发的一个轻量级iOS本地语音识别框架,提供了一种无需云端服务即可在iOS设备上进行高效语音转文本的方式。通过利用Apple的Core ML和AVFoundation库,开发者可以快速集成这一功能到自己的应用中,提高用户体验,同时也保护了用户的隐私。项目简介ASR-iOS-Local的核心在于一个预先训练好的模型,该模型基于Apple的Siri数
**输入流:东西读入内存 输出流:东西从内存写到记录存储**因为我们本身是以记录存储为原点来判读输入和输出的概念,所有会有弄错的时候。 在java中, io流按照java io流的方向可以分为输入流和输出流。 输入流是将资源数据读入到缓冲Buffer中,输出流是将缓冲Buffer中的数据按照指定格式写出到一个指定的位置,所以这两个流一般同时使用,才有意义。 例如你要做文件的上传,你要先用输
1. JAVA流式输入/输出原理在Java程序中,对于数据的输入/输出操作以“流”(Stream)方式进行;Java提供了各种各样的“流”类,用以获取不同种类的数据:程序中通过标准的方法输入或输出数据。读入写出流是用来读写数据的,java有一个类叫File,它封装的是文件的文件名,只是内存里面的一个对象,真正的文件是在硬盘上的一块空间,在这个文件里面存放着各种各样的数据,我们想读文件里面的数据怎么
转载 2024-02-04 11:36:50
200阅读
一、Java输入输出流1.1 概述1、流,简单的来说,就是数据流动管道。Java规定,输入流是从数据源到程序,输出流是从程序到目的地,输入流是源设备发出的,而输出流是目标设备。 注意,这里的输入/输出流是相对于程序来说,并不是相对数据源 。2、在这里我来解释一下什么是 节点流,处理流节点流:可以直接从着数据源和目的地读取数据。处理流:不是直接连接着数据源和目的地,是“
转载 2024-07-01 13:43:14
944阅读
1.什么是IO       Java中I/O操作主要是指使用Java进行输入,输出操作. Java所有的I/O机制都是基于数据流进行输入输出,这些数据流表示了字符或者字节数据的流动序列。Java的I/O流提供了读写数据的标准方法。任何Java中表示数据源的对象都会提供以数据流的方式读写它的数据的方法。     &nb
转载 2023-11-21 11:18:02
72阅读
# Java控制台流式输入 在Java编程中,控制台输入是一种非常基础且常用的功能。通过控制台输入,我们可以与程序进行交互,输入数据并查看程序的输出结果。在本文中,我们将重点介绍如何在Java中使用流式输入从控制台读取输入数据。 ## 流式输入概述 流是Java中用于处理输入输出的一种机制,它允许程序以流的形式读取和写入数据。在控制台输入中,我们通常使用`System.in`来代表标准输入
原创 2024-06-09 04:56:51
20阅读
输入流和输出流 按照流的流向来分,可以分为输入流和输出流。输入,输出都是从程序运行所在内存的角度来划分的。 输入流:只能从中读取数据,而不能向其写入数据,由InputStream和Reader作为基类。 输出流:只能向其写入数据,而不能从中读取数据。由OutputStream和Writer作为基类。   这是在d盘中创建一个a的文件,然后再a文件中写入。public stati
对于Fortran程序的所有输入和输出,应使用命名管道,以避免写入磁盘。然后,在使用者中,您可以使用线程从程序的每个输出源读取信息,并将信息添加到队列中以进行顺序处理。为了对此进行建模,我创建了一个python应用程序daemon.py,它从标准输入读取并返回平方根,直到EOF。它将所有输入记录到指定为命令行参数的日志文件中,并将平方根打印到stdout,将所有错误打印到stderr。我认为它模拟
发一下牢骚和主题无关:    工厂模式:    //如果一个方法参数是接口,那么调用方法时,必须传入该接口的实现类对象    //如果一个方法返回值是接口,那么可以返回任何一个该接口实现类     输入输出流: &nbs
本节内容如下:什么是IO文件内容操作 操作文本文件 操作二进制文件内存IO 初步认识io模块目录和文件的操作 初步认识os模块 文件的创建、重命名、删除 目录的创建、重命名、删除序列化操作1. 什么是IOIO:Input/Output~输入/输出的意思任何编程语言,核心都是对数据的处理,对数据的处理一般情况下就是指代数据的输入和输出 常规情况下,我们在程序运行的过程中,将数据频繁的输入或者输出到计
1. 简介在解释BFC之前,先说一下文档流。我们常说的文档流其实分为定位流、浮动流、普通流三种。而普通流其实就是指BFC中的FC。FC(Formatting Context),直译过来是格式化上下文,它是页面中的一块渲染区域,有一套渲染规则,决定了其子元素如何布局,以及和其他元素之间的关系和作用。常见的FC有BFC、IFC,还有GFC和FFC。BFC(Block Formatting Contex
转载 1月前
382阅读
Java流式输入/输出原理在Java程序中,对于数据的输入/输出操作以“流”(Stream)方式进行; J2SDK 提供了各种各样的“流”类,用以获取不同种类的数据;程序中通过标准的方法输入或输出数据。Java流类的分类java.io 包中定义了多个流类型(类或抽象类)来实现输入/输出功能;可以从不同的角度对其进行分类: (以后都是站在程序的角度上来说输入/输出流)字节流:按字节读;字符流:按字符
  • 1
  • 2
  • 3
  • 4
  • 5